My First Tarot Card Reading

03.01.18 | jesslynnwrites | No Comments

YAUJ3733[1]I thought I would start out the new year on the blog with something I had done to prepare for 2018. As the title suggests, I had my very first tarot reading. Now, I don’t really want to go into grave detail about what each card meant for me. That would take forever and each card, depending on the deck and other sources, could have other meanings.

I do want to talk about my experience and what I got out of my reading. Luckily, I had my best friend introduce me to the world of tarot. I can tell you that having her do, instead of someone I don’t know, put my mind at ease. Before I go any further with my experience, I want to say that I never truly was interested in or believed in tarot card readings. I always thought they were a bunch of hooey. Turns out I do believe in them.

Okay, back to my experience. I learned a lot, not just about the card itself, but also about tarot. Each card can mean something different and be interpreted differently. I find this interesting. I also found it interesting and crazy how accurate, or not accurate, each card could be. All in all, it was just a really cool experience to see how my year could pan out.

And now that I have had a reading, I want a deck of my own. I want to do my own readings. Most decks come with a book, or at least this one did, and it has all kinds of ways to do a reading. I think it would be fun to do one every once in awhile or everyday just to see how my day is going to go, or even week. I still don’t know a lot about tarot, but I would love to learn.
